PLC 328040.31 – Control Unit, Supply Voltage Too Low

Code: 328040.31

Shortcode:

Description:

This diagnostic trouble code is generated when the control unit registers a supply voltage of less than 9 volts. Low supply voltage can affect the performance and reliability of the control unit.

Reaction:

The control unit may operate erratically or fail to perform certain functions due to insufficient power supply. This can lead to various operational issues.

Recommendations:

  • Inspect Power Supply:
    • Check the power supply connections to the control unit for any loose or corroded connectors. Repair or replace as needed.
  • Test Battery and Alternator:
    • Ensure that the battery and alternator are functioning correctly and providing adequate voltage. Replace if necessary.
  • Check Wiring:
    • Inspect the wiring between the power source and the control unit for any signs of damage or wear. Repair or replace damaged sections.
  • Secure Connections:
    • Ensure all power supply connections are secure and free from contamination.

Note:

Maintaining a stable and adequate power supply is crucial for the reliable operation of the control unit. Regular checks can help prevent low voltage issues.
